CS-355T
Exhaust Port Cleaning
Level 2.
Parts Required:
As needed: Muffler Gasket
1. Remove spark plug cover (A) and remove spark
plug lead (B).
2. Release chain brake, and remove guide bar nuts,
clutch cover, guide bar, and chain.
3. Remove muffler cover screws and remove muffler
cover. (See “Guide Bar and Saw Chain – Install/
Remove” in Instruction Manual for detailed disas-
sembly instructions.)
4. Place piston at top dead center.
5. Remove muffler bolts (C), muffler (D), muffler gas
-
ket and plate (E). Check parts for wear or damage,
and replace if necessary.
6. Use a wood or plastic scraping tool to clean depos-
its from cylinder exhaust ports (F).
F
7. Install muffler bolts (C), muffler (D), muffler gasket
and plate (E). Tighten bolts to 70 kgf • cm (7 N-m,
60 in • lbf), but do not exceed specifications, other
-
wise damage to bolts may occur.
8. Connect spark plug lead and replace spark plug
cover.
9. Start engine, and allow unit to warm up
at idle
for
several minutes.
10. Stop engine, and re-tighten muffler bolts to 70 kgf •
cm (7 N-m, 60 in • lbf), but do not exceed specifica
-
tions, otherwise damage to bolts may occur.
11. Install muffler cover and tighten screws.
12. Install guide bar and chain, clutch cover, and guide
bar nuts, tightening nuts until finger tight. Adjust
chain tension as instructed in “Adjustment, Chain
Tension” section of instruction manual.
13. Start engine and check for exhaust leaks between
muffler and cylinder head. Stop engine if leak is
found and correct problem before operating chain
saw.
